Urban Compass, Inc., which is Compass, is a real estate brokerage company. The company is headquartered in New York, New York.

IHS Holding Limited owns, operates and develops shared telecommunications infrastructure in Africa, Latin America, Europe and the Middle East. The company is headquartered in London, the United Kingdom.
